Suggest Treatment For Pigmentation And Black Spots On Face

Hello Dr. I am 28 yr old. one year back i got melasma / black spot on the nose i consulted a dermatologist and dr suggested me to use Triglow-M. it was really effective i saw the results in a month, spots were becoming lighter. but when i stopped using it after 6 months i got severe acne problem. acne is fine now. I use sunscreen Taiyu. but now again some pgmentation or black spots are there on my face specially on cheecks. nw dr has advised me to use Melalite. shall i use it because my skin is very sensitive. my skinwas fair but now becoming darker.. please suggest

Dermatologist 's  Response
Hi,

I can understand your concern pigmentation and black spots on face.

The important things to tell you regarding pigmentation and black spots on face:

-use a sunscreen daily.

-protect yourself from direct long term sun exposure.

-Do not use any cosmetics on face.

- In my patients I use kojic acid and azelaic acid at night time.

- DO not use any steroid based cream as can harm you rather than benefiting.

Take proper treatment from a dermatologist to get good relief.
